How to sign up and get verified – a step‑by‑step walk‑through
The registration form at Playamo is intentionally short: email, password, and a choice of currency. Australian users should pick “AUD” to keep exchange rates transparent. After confirming the email, the next hurdle is the KYC (Know Your Customer) check. You’ll be asked for a photo ID and a utility bill – a process that can feel bureaucratic but usually takes under 24 hours if the documents are clear.
Tip: keep the scan of your driver’s licence handy and make sure the file size is under 5 MB. Uploading a blurry image will send your verification back to the start and delay any bonus credits. Once verified, the account is flagged “ready for withdrawals”, which is the green light for playing with real money.
Welcome bonus and wagering requirements – what to look for
Playamo’s headline offer is a 100 % match on the first deposit up to AU$1,000, plus 100 free spins. It sounds generous, but the real cost is hidden in the wagering requirements – usually 30 × the bonus amount. That means a AU$500 bonus must be bet through AU$15,000 before any cash can be withdrawn.
When comparing to other Australian casinos, ask yourself:
- Is the wagering requirement lower than 30 ×?
- Do the free spins contribute to the wagering?
- Can the bonus be used on high‑RTP slots or only on specific titles?
If the answer to any of those is “no”, you might be better off taking a smaller, low‑wager bonus elsewhere.
Payment methods, deposit limits and withdrawal speed
Australian players have a decent range of options at Playamo: credit cards, e‑wallets such as Skrill and Neteller, and a handful of crypto wallets. Deposits are instant, but the real test is the withdrawal pipeline. Below is a quick comparison of the most common methods.
| Method | Deposit Limit (per transaction) | Withdrawal Speed | Fees |
|---|---|---|---|
| Visa / Mastercard | AU$5,000 | 2‑4 business days | None |
| Skrill | AU$3,000 | Within 24 hours | None |
| Neteller | AU$3,000 | Within 24 hours | None |
| Bitcoin | AU$10,000 | Instant to 1 hour | Network fee only |
For most Aussies, the instant‑pay e‑wallets are the sweet spot – you get quick payouts without the need to share bank details. Keep in mind that Playamo may ask for additional verification if you withdraw more than AU$5,000 in a single request.
Game library, live casino and sports betting options
The software backbone at Playamo is powered by leading providers like NetEnt, Microgaming and Evolution. That means you’ll find high‑RTP slots such as “Mega Joker” (RTP ≈ 99 %) alongside high‑volatility titles like “Dead or Alive 2”. The live casino section runs 24/7 with real dealers for blackjack, roulette and baccarat – a nice touch if you miss the feel of a brick‑and‑mortar venue.
Playamo also houses a modest sportsbook, covering major Australian leagues (NRL, AFL) and international events. While the odds are competitive, the betting interface feels a bit clunky on desktop – the mobile version smooths this out considerably.

Security, licensing and responsible gambling
Playamo operates under a Curacao eGaming licence, which is recognised internationally but not as strict as an Australian licence. To compensate, the site employs 128‑bit SSL encryption and regular third‑party audits of its RNG (random number generator). For Australian players who value local oversight, this is a point to weigh against the bonus generosity.
Responsible gambling tools are built into the player account – you can set deposit limits, loss limits, or self‑exclude for a chosen period. If you ever feel you need a break, the “Responsible Gaming” tab links directly to an Australian support hotline and a self‑exclusion form.
